The B2B Search Deficit Six Failure Modes
B2B buyers don't browse — they search with precision. Each failure mode below represents measurable, recoverable revenue loss.

01
Trade terms don't match product titles
Buyers use industry shorthand your catalog doesn't reflect. Every mismatch is a lost order.

02
Attribute filtering is too shallow
Engineers filter by spec, grade, and certification — not by category name. Standard facets fail them.

03
Large catalogs degrade in performance
Relevance and speed collapse above 100,000 SKUs on most platforms. SearchSense doesn't.

04
Part number search isn't treated precisely
SKUs and model codes need atomic matching. Generic tokenisation returns wrong or no results.

05
Reorder friction erodes loyalty
Trade buyers who can't quickly repeat an order find a supplier whose system remembers them.

06
Internal teams can't access product knowledge
Sales reps hunting through shared drives during customer calls lose deals to faster competitors.
